 <content:encoded>&lt;div class='rss_texte'&gt;La cinqui&#232;me &#233;dition du Forum Social Africain plac&#233;e sous le th&#232;me : &#171; l'Afrique des peuples en marche contre la mondialisation n&#233;olib&#233;rale &#187; a &#233;t&#233; particuli&#232;rement marqu&#233;e par la pr&#233;sence massive des paysans, des femmes, des clubs et fadas de la capitale et surtout des jeunes visiblement engag&#233;s dans la lutte pour une autre Afrique possible &#224; travers leur participation au niveau des diff&#233;rents panels, conf&#233;rences pl&#233;ni&#232;res, ateliers th&#233;matiques et autres activit&#233;s autog&#233;r&#233;es pr&#233;vues pour la circonstance.
Le campement de la jeunesse Frantz Fanon, situ&#233; au stade municipal de Niamey a servi de cadre pour des centaines des jeunes, tant&#244;t dans les salles tant&#244;t assis sur des nattes autour du th&#233;, de discuter sur des sujets aussi importants comme les enjeux d'une r&#233;forme des institutions internationales, le drame de l'immigration, les questions d'&#233;ducation, d'emploi sans oublier le r&#244;le de la jeunesse, en tant que fer de lance, dans la dynamique de d&#233;mocratisation, de l'unit&#233; et de la souverainet&#233; du continent noir.
Conscients de leur majorit&#233; num&#233;rique sur les quelques 900millions d'habitants qui se partagent un continent riche mais appauvri et de leur place marginale surtout lorsqu'il s'agit de d&#233;finir et de mettre en &#339;uvre des politiques affectant immanquablement leur avenir, les jeunes d'Afrique ont innov&#233; en ajoutant aux dix sept(17) th&#232;mes soumis &#224; leur analyse par le comit&#233; organisateur nig&#233;rien, un autre d&#233;fi portant sur la structuration de la jeunesse africaine . Ainsi, apr&#232;s une s&#233;rie d'interminables &#233;changes ponctu&#233;s par un m&#233;ga concert qui a vu la participation, dans la nuit du 27 Novembre, des artistes locaux et de Didier Awadi, un artiste s&#233;n&#233;galais engag&#233; pour la cause et sous les applaudissements d'une dizaine de milliers de spectateurs, les locataires du campement Frantz Fanon ont fini par mettre en place un R&#233;seau des Jeunes pour une Autre Afrique Possible (RJAP). A travers ce cadre de lutte qui regroupe la jeunesse du Maroc, d'Alg&#233;rie, de Nigeria, de C&#244;te d'Ivoire, du Burkina, du Togo, de la Guin&#233;e, du Cameroun, du Mali, du S&#233;n&#233;gal, du B&#233;nin, de la Mauritanie et du Niger en raison de deux repr&#233;sentants par pays, la jeunesse africaine, &#171; victime du larbinisme de ses gouvernants complices de la d&#233;sertification &#233;conomique du continent &#187;, consciente des enjeux et des d&#233;fis anciens et &#233;mergents, &#171; s'engage, &#224; en croire aux recommandations de la rencontre, dans le mouvement altermondialiste, en tant qu'acteurs &#224; part enti&#232;re, &#224; participer, sans r&#233;serve, &#224; la construction d'une autre Afrique possible &#187;. Selon les conclusions de l'Assembl&#233;e constitutive tenue en marge de cette 5eme &#233;dition du FSA, le RJAP reste ouvert &#224; l'adh&#233;sion des jeunes des autres pays d'Afrique partageant les m&#234;mes objectifs. Ces derniers visent en premier chef &#171; l'&#233;ducation et la mobilisation de masses populaires contre cette avilissante mondialisation n&#233;olib&#233;rale &#187;.
Pour les jeunes d'Afrique, le RJAP n&#233; dans les sillages du forum social africain, est l'occasion de p&#233;renniser et de renforcer la mise en place d'une synergie d'actions entre les diff&#233;rents mouvements progressistes, en vue de cheminer vers cette autre Afrique possible jalouse de sa dignit&#233; s&#233;v&#232;rement bafou&#233;e par les politiques n&#233;olib&#233;rales et les lois anti-immigration occidentales ; cette autre Afrique possible qui revendique et assume son droit au libre choix politique, &#233;conomique et social. Il s'agit pour eux, de lutter pour une Afrique effectivement d&#233;mocratique, unie et souveraine et qui refuse, sans complexe aucun, d'&#234;tre sacrifi&#233;e sur l'autel de la d&#233;shumanisante mondialisation n&#233;olib&#233;rale.
En d&#233;pit des prises de position souvent tr&#232;s passionn&#233;es, les participants ont privil&#233;gi&#233; ce qui les rassemble. La rigueur sur le respect des principes d&#233;mocratiques est le cr&#233;do manifeste des jeunes pr&#233;sents &#224; toutes ces discutions. C'est ainsi qu'au cour de la journ&#233;e du 27 Novembre, lors du d&#233;bat des jeunes dans la salle Kwame Nkrumah, une personnalit&#233; mauritanienne venue pour d&#233;fendre la junte au pouvoir dans son pays, a &#233;t&#233; vite expuls&#233;e de la salle par les jeunes d&#233;fenseurs des valeurs d&#233;mocratiques, au nom du principe d'opposition cat&#233;gorique &#224; la prise de pouvoir par la force.&lt;/div&gt;

		&lt;div class='rss_chapo'&gt;Du 25 au 28 novembre 2008, les mouvements sociaux africains qui ont converg&#233; &#224; Niamey dans le cadre de la cinqui&#232;me &#233;dition du Forum Social Africain ont intensifi&#233; leur opposition et leur r&#233;sistance &#224; l'&#233;gard du mod&#232;le n&#233;olib&#233;ral. Au cours de ce grand rendez des altermondialistes, les d&#233;bats et les r&#233;flexions ont &#233;t&#233; orient&#233;s dans la recherche des alternatives populaires et d&#233;mocratiques au libre &#233;change, &#224; la dette ill&#233;gitime, &#224; la corruption, &#224; la migration, et &#224; aux crises alimentaire, financi&#232;re et &#233;nerg&#233;tique.&lt;/div&gt;
		&lt;div class='rss_texte'&gt;&l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Plus de 10.000 personnes ont particip&#233; &#224; la marche d'ouverture de la cinqui&#232;me &#233;dition du Forum Social Africain (FSA) de Niamey. De la place Toumo &#224; la place de la Concertation , terminus de la marche et lieu du meeting, les manifestants venus d'horizons divers ont scand&#233; des slogans anticapitalistes et anti-imp&#233;rialistes. Sur des banderoles, on pouvait lire : &#171; non &#224; la dette, nous ne devons rien &#187;, &#171; Accord de Partenariat Economique &#233;gale &#224; augmentation de la d&#233;pendance &#233;conomique &#187;, &#171; nous exigeons la reprise par l'Etat des soci&#233;t&#233;s privatis&#233;es &#187;, &#171; non &#224; la contractualisation sauvage de l'emploi &#187;. Comme l'annonce le th&#232;me de cette cinqui&#232;me &#233;dition du FSA : L'Afrique des peuples &#233;tait ce jour l&#224; en marche contre la mondialisation n&#233;olib&#233;rale . Le comit&#233; organisateur nig&#233;rien a r&#233;ussi son pari. Taoufic Ben Abdallah, secr&#233;taire du Forum social africain a salu&#233; les efforts d&#233;ploy&#233;s par ce comit&#233; malgr&#233; les maigres ressources financi&#232;res dont il disposait.
Le coordonnateur du comit&#233; national d'organisation, Moussa Tchangari, n'a pas cach&#233; lui,sa satisfaction pour cette grande mobilisation des alter mondialistes, venus du Niger, d'Afrique, d'Am&#233;rique et d'Europe pour participer &#224; cette cinqui&#232;me &#233;dition du Forum Social Africain. &#171; Je suis fier de vous tous &#187;, a-t-il clam&#233; fort.
Successivement sur la tribune, Taoufik Ben Abdallah, secr&#233;taire du Forum Social Africain, Aminata Dramane Traor&#233; du Forum Social malien, Diori Ibrahim coordonnateur du campement de la jeunesse et plusieurs autres invit&#233;s ont pris la parole pour galvaniser la mar&#233;e humaine qui continuait &#224; scander des propos hostiles &#224; l'ordre n&#233;olib&#233;ral.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Le proc&#232;s de la mondialisation n&#233;o-lib&#233;rale&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Le Palais de sport de Niamey, site qui a accueilli les activit&#233;s de la cinqui&#232;me &#233;dition du Forum Social Africain a servi de tribunal aux altermondialistes pour faire le proc&#232;s de la mondialisation n&#233;o-lib&#233;rale. La question sur le droit &#224; l'alimentation a &#233;t&#233; au centre des d&#233;bats du FSA. Une conf&#233;rence pl&#233;ni&#232;re sur &#8220;le droit &#224; l'alimentation &#224; l'&#233;preuve de la mondialisation n&#233;olib&#233;rale&#8221;, a &#233;t&#233; anim&#233;e par Moussa Tchangari, coordonnateur du consortium des associations et ONG qui plaident pour le droit &#224; l'alimentation au Sahel. Dans les s&#233;ries de conf&#233;rences sur l'Afrique dans l'arc des crises, la crise alimentaire en Afrique a suscit&#233; de grands d&#233;bats dans la salle Patrice Lumumba du Palais des sports. Selon la conf&#233;renci&#232;re Madame Hima Fatimatou Djibo, la secr&#233;taire g&#233;n&#233;rale la Plate Forme Paysanne du Niger, l'offensive du capital sur les ressources naturelles n'est plus &#224; d&#233;montrer. La pouss&#233;e du capital a d&#233;pouill&#233; l'Afrique de ses terres cultivables, de ses for&#234;ts, de ses eaux et de ses minerais. Du coup la population rurale et l'environnement sont menac&#233;s par les multinationales. &#171; Les arguments, comme les crises climatiques et &#233;nerg&#233;tiques ont contribu&#233; &#224; l'intensification des plantations d'agro carburants sur des grandes surfaces de cultures au d&#233;triment des cultures vivri&#232;res &#187;, a-t-elle indiqu&#233;. A c&#244;t&#233; de ces facteurs qui aggravent la crise alimentaire au Niger, Madame Hima Fatimatou Djibo, a &#233;voqu&#233; la question de la concurrence entre le carburant industriel d'origine agricole et l'alimentation. &#171; Le FMI, la Banque Mondiale, et l'OMC doivent &#234;tre &#233;limin&#233; et mettre en place d'autres institutions de r&#233;gulation de l'&#233;conomie mondiale, sans servir les int&#233;r&#234;ts d'une poign&#233;e de privil&#233;gi&#233;e &#187;, a soutenu la conf&#233;renci&#232;re. De l'avis de plusieurs intervenants, la souverainet&#233; alimentaire en Afrique doit &#234;tre fond&#233;e sur les connaissances des paysans qui sont le moteur de la production en Afrique.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;La dette odieuse et asphyxiante&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&#171; La Banque Mondiale, le Fonds Mon&#233;taire International, les banques du Nord pr&#234;tent pour leurs propres int&#233;r&#234;ts avec la complicit&#233; des gouvernants des pays du Sud &#187;, a laiss&#233; entendre un alter mondialiste malien, au cours du d&#233;bat en pl&#233;ni&#232;re sur la dette. La dette des pays africains a &#233;t&#233; contract&#233;e selon des m&#233;canismes qui &#233;chappent aux citoyens. &#171; Seuls les gouvernants peuvent expliquer les conditionnalit&#233;s &#187;, a indiqu&#233; Yoro Bi de C&#244;te d'Ivoire. De l'avis de Ibrahim Yacouba, du R&#233;seau Nig&#233;rien Dette et D&#233;veloppement (RNDD), en 1975 la dette ext&#233;rieure publique du Niger &#233;tait de 27 milliards. Elle a &#233;t&#233; quasiment multipli&#233;e par pr&#232;s de 40 en 2000, pour d&#233;passer 1000 milliards. Malgr&#233; l'explosion et l'exploitation de l'uranium, la pauvret&#233; s'approfondit dans les m&#234;mes proportions avec les plus forts taux de mortalit&#233; infantile et maternelle, les plus bas taux d'acc&#232;s &#224; l'&#233;ducation et &#224; la sant&#233; publique. Selon Olivier Bonfon du Comit&#233; pour l'Annulation de la Dette du Tiers Monde (CADTM Belgique), la dette des pays du tiers-monde entre 1960 et 2007/2008 est divis&#233;e en quatre p&#233;riodes charni&#232;res. La premi&#232;re va de 1960 &#224; la crise de 1982 qui a vu la dette osciller au tour de seulement 50 milliards de dollars pour tous les pays du tiers-monde. La seconde couvrant la p&#233;riode de 1982 &#224; 2001 durant laquelle elle va passer &#224; 600 milliards de dollars avant d'exploser pendant le troisi&#232;me grand moment allant de 2001 &#224; 2007/2008 et vaciller autour de 2500 milliards. Une quatri&#232;me &#232;re s'ouvre donc pour les pays pauvres, et la situation, de l'avis des experts , pourrait &#234;tre alarmante avec l'augmentation des taux d'int&#233;r&#234;ts et la chute du cours des mati&#232;res premi&#232;res. Cette politique d'aust&#233;rit&#233; avait compl&#232;tement d&#233;sarticul&#233; l'ossature socio &#233;conomique des pays pauvres. Les in&#233;galit&#233;s augmentent et les services publics se d&#233;gradent. Les participants &#224; cette conf&#233;rence ont demand&#233; aux Etats africains l'arr&#234;t du paiement de la dette. &#171; Mais, il nous faut , pour porter une telle revendication, un vaste mouvement social suffisamment fort &#187;, a pr&#233;cis&#233; Ibrahim Yacouba du RNDD.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Forte mobilisation des jeunes&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Les jeunes se sont mobilis&#233;s au niveau de leur campement qui porte le nom du c&#233;l&#232;bre &#233;crivain Frantz Fanon. Les d&#233;bats sur l'&#233;pineuse question de la migration a &#233;t&#233; l'un des temps forts des discussions au niveau du site des jeunes. Selon Ou&#233;drago Moussa, du Burkina Faso, le dispositif de surveillance europ&#233;en ne peut pas mettre fin &#224; la migration clandestine. &#171; Ce n'est pas le go&#251;t de l'aventure qui anime les jeunes, qui risquent leur vie en haute mer et dans les d&#233;serts, mais la fuite de la mis&#232;re &#187;, a-t-il indiqu&#233;. Aujourd'hui beaucoup de jeunes africains pr&#233;f&#232;rent mourir en mer que de rester vivre dans la mis&#232;re. De l'avis de ces jeunes, cette migration &#8216;' &#233;conomique'' est le produit de l'&#233;chec des politiques n&#233;olib&#233;rales impos&#233;es aux pays africains par l'interm&#233;diaire de la Banque mondiale et du FMI. &#171; Ce sont nos dirigeants corrompus qui ont contribu&#233; &#224; cette situation de pillage de l'Afrique et du maintien de sa jeunesse dans la mis&#232;re &#187;, a d&#233;clar&#233; A. Gaston du mouvement des Peuples du Togo. C'est pourquoi les jeunes participants &#224; ce campement de Niamey ont mis en place un r&#233;seau de jeunes panafricains.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/div&gt;

 <content:encoded>&lt;div class='rss_texte'&gt;&l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;The African Social Forum in Niger will begin with a march in the afternoon of Day 1. The starting point of the march will be the Place de la Concertation, located opposite the Parliament, ending with a rally in front General Seyni Kountch&#233; Stadium, the official venue of the ASF. The opening event will be militant, festive, swarming and rich in colors. At the end of march, a popular show called MARHABA &#8211; which means welcome in Hausa, the most spoken language in Niger &#8211; will be held at General Seyni Kountch&#233; Stadium.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;MARHABA is a show that appeals to all dimensions of living art, namely music, drama and dance. This is a show that calls for unity of hearts and minds, the intermingling between members of African communities united around a culture rich in its diversity.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;At the beginning, the royal drum starts to resound and we can see men, women and children running from left to right. Screams can be heard here and some hailing there. The body of music, which has just settled down, starts playing and soon the scene is taken over by a frenzy crowd.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;The Golden Jubilee of hunters is par excellence a festival which also enables other social classes to make the best of themselves before their king. Thus, blacksmiths, barbers, butchers, warriors, weavers await you. They are, just as the formidable hunters of His Majesty, handsome in their ceremonial costumes. Music, songs and dances are at their peak. Fantasy and demonstration will, that day, be the watchwords &amp;hellip; To that show, one need to add a HIP HOP concert and other cultural activities by artists from Niger and other countries in the sub-region.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/div&gt;

 <content:encoded>&lt;div class='rss_texte'&gt;&l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Communication&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;To ensure great visibility before, during and after the forum, the communication strategy of the 5th edition of FSA 2008 will focus on the following points:&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;1.&lt;/strong&gt;	Optimizing the media and the communication means of the ASF and the Nigerien Organizing Committee (Africa Flames, mailing lists, Alternative Newspaper and Radio);&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;2.&lt;/strong&gt;	Using all the traditional and modern communication channels to inform and mobilize the population around the event: films, drama, interpersonal communication etc.,&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;
3.&lt;/strong&gt;	Using existing websites by creating and / or updating a specific page on the 5th edition of the Niamey ASF (Websites of the ASF, WASF, NSF, etc.);&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;4.&lt;/strong&gt;	Engaging national and sub-regional Social Forums to give information about the Niamey ASF through their mailing lists and websites.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Translation&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;During the plenary conferences and some of the thematic workshops, the working languages will be French and English. Within the limits of logistics and human resources which can be mobilized, simultaneous translation will be offered from one language to the other. To this end, we plan to move from Nairobi to Niamey some of the translation equipment which was used during the 2007 Social Forum World. Moreover, the ASF Secretariat will mobilize its network of volunteer translators who attended the previous editions of the ASF. In order to enable Nigerien delegates who do not speak or understand these two languages to take part the Nigerien Organizing Committee will arrange to provide summaries of the interventions in Hausa and Zarma, the most spoken languages in Niger. Participants who wish to take part in the debates in their native language can do it and a translation of their intervention will be ensured within existing possibilities. Moreover, within the framework of the self-governed workshops the organizers of the activity are free to choose their working language and make arrangements for possible translation into other languages.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/div&gt;

 <content:encoded>&lt;div class='rss_texte'&gt;&l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;What are the stakes and objectives of the caravan for dignity?&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;The answer to that question lies in this quote from Edouard Glissant and Patrick Chamoiseau in their letter to the Minister of Interior of the Republic of France of the time, Mr. Nicolas Sarkozy during his visit to Martinique &quot;situations of dehumanization are valuable in that they preserve in the heart of the dominated, the excitement from which always rises a demand for dignity &quot;.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;The caravan for dignity is an initiative of African women, following the tragic events in Ceuta and Melilla, they committed themselves to a clarification and information task about the root causes of African immigration. As part of the 5th edition of the African Social Forum in Niamey, that initiative will be expanded and consolidated in order to raise awareness throughout Africa and the rest of the world on the close links between neoliberal globalization and migratory flows. More specifically, it is for the various components of the African social movement to create at the local, national, sub-regional and regional level dynamics which can result in:&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; A communication and exchange work on the stakes and the agenda of the Niamey ASF;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; The mobilization of African populations by putting forward the role of women, the media and of cultural actors;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Awareness actions throughout the whole the way from each capital city to Niamey.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;In the continuity of Migrances 2008, to be held in Bamako in Mali, from 3 to 6 October, 2008, the caravan for dignity is aimed at:&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; mobilizing artists and intellectuals in the dialogue with young people, their training and their support in their quest for alternatives to the consequences of global disorder;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; sharing as widely as possible, information on the major causes of recent migratory flows towards Europe and on the hardening of European migratory policies through FRONTEX, the &quot;return&quot; directive, the European Pact, the Union for the Mediterranean;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; promoting and disseminating citizen initiatives in conformity with the aspirations and real needs of potential immigrants with the criminalisation of Trans-Saharan and maritime migratory flows
&l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; redefining the meaning and the twists and turns of solidarity between old and young people, between those who govern and those being governed, the migrants' countries of origin, the countries bordering the Sahara as well as with Latin America and the peoples of peoples.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;
Process of the caravan for dignity&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;The ASF Council held in Abidjan from 10 to 13 August 2008 recommended that we seize the opportunity offered by the organization of some African and international events o raise awareness and mobilize African public and world opinion on the caravan for dignity. Those events include:&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; the Forum for the Liberation of Grenoble (18 to 20 September 2008); &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; the Paris Citizen summit on migration (17 to 18 October 2008) &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Migrances 2008 in Bamako (03 to 06 October 2008) &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; the Nigerian Social Forum of Inugu (03 to 06 November 2008) &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Organizing press conferences in different countries of departure for the caravan on the issues of the 2008 ASF in Niamey and the objectives of the caravan for dignity;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Launching on the ASF website a virtual caravan for dignity for the other countries;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Convergence of all caravans towards Niamey where they are expected on 23 November 2008.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/div&gt;

 <content:encoded>&lt;div class='rss_texte'&gt;&l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;In principle, the African Social Forum is a space open to any individual, association, NGO, movement, coalition etc., which adheres to its Charter of Principles and values. The 5th edition in Niamey aims to bring together several thousands of participants from:&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; African countries representing the five sub-regions (North, West, Central, Eastern and Southern Africa) &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; The African Diaspora &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; The Social Movement of the North and South &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; National, sub-regional, regional and international institutions
&l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Trade unions, NGOs, farmers' organizations, associations, social movements;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; National and local elected representatives &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; National, sub-regional, regional and international thematic networks &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; The Media &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Researchers and research institutions &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; Opinion leaders etc.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;The main concern is around the mobilization of national, African and international participants: that is how to ensure broad participation of citizens from inside of Niger, countries in the west African sub-region, other African countries and the rest of the world? After several discussions, the 5th edition of ASF has set out the following objectives:&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; To get between 1200 and 1500 participants from inside of Niger coming from the following areas: Agadez, Diffa, Dosso, Maradi, Tahoua, Tillabery and Zinder. The aim is to provide bus transportation to about 170 to 200 participants in each area.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; To get at least three thousand (3000) delegates from Niamey, coming from the trade unions, associations, NGOs, social movements and the popular districts; &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; To organize a caravan for dignity, across West Africa, departing from 10 West African capital cities and heading for Niamey as a converging point. A 70-seat bus will be provided for each country, making up a total of 700 West African delegates. The caravan routes are as follows:&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Route1:&lt;/strong&gt; Accra - Lome &#8211;Cotonou -Niamey;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Route 2:&lt;/strong&gt; Abidjan &#8211; Ouagadougou &#8211; Niamey;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Route 3:&lt;/strong&gt; Dakar &#8211; Bamako &#8211; Ouagadougou &#8211; Niamey;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Route 4:&lt;/strong&gt; Nouakchott &#8211; Conakry &#8211; Bamako &#8211; Ouagadougou &#8211; Niamey;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Route 5:&lt;/strong&gt; Abuja &#8211; Cotonou &#8211; Niamey;&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;strong class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;Route 6:&lt;/strong&gt; Northern Nigeria &#8211; Konni &#8211; Niamey.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; To get 80 delegates from the other African countries to take part on the basis of twenty participants for each sub-region (North Africa, East Africa; Central Africa, Southern Africa); &lt;br /&gt;&lt;img src='http://fsaniamey2008.org/local/cache-vignettes/L13xH13/pucegif-79827982-f1ac9.gif' alt='-' width='13' height='13' style='height:13px;width:13px;' class='' /&gt; To mobilize around fifty (50) delegates from other regions of the world (Americas Europe, Asia).&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;On the whole, the Nigerien Organizing Committee, the Secretariat and the ASF Council intend to mobilize, if all conditions are met, several thousands delegates in the 5th edition of the African Social Forum.&lt;/p&gt; &lt;p class=&quot;spip&quot;&gt;The mobilization of national actors is entirely the responsibility of the Nigerien Organizing Committee. As for the caravan for dignity, coordinating its practical organization will be ensured by the Forum for Another Mali (FORAM). As for international participants and those from other African sub-regions it is the responsibility of the Secretariat and of the ASF Council to mobilize them.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/div&gt;
